Boys Tennis: Wingers falls to Elk River at Eagan Tournament

The Red Wing boys tennis team lost its only match in a rain-shortened tournament Saturday in Eagan.

The Red Wing boys tennis team lost its only match in a rain-shortened tournament Saturday in Eagan.

The Wingers (3-1) fell 7-0 to Elk River.

“They’re probably a top-5 team in the state,” Red Wing head coach Randy Decker said. “Their top six players are all phenomenal. They have a shot to win state this year, they’re that good.”

Alex Holm and Noah Christenson put up good efforts at No. 3 and No. 4 singles, respectively, against tough opponents. Holm faced Ryan Ness, who Decker said is undefeated this season with five of his six wins coming 6-0, 6-0. Holm lost 6-3, 6-0.

“It was good tennis,” Decker said. “I was really impressed with Noah and Alex.”

Christenson fell 6-3, 7-5 to Joshua Chuba.

The Wingers face Northfield Tuesday in Northfield.
